Blog

Light fitting monitor

Up to 12 of this devices can be used to form a sub GHz mesh network based on the custom protocol. In this network, device can be master or a slave. Difference is, that the master has the access to the WiFi network and slave doesn’t. Data from slave is sent to the master through mesh network. Master will received all data from slave devices and it will send it to the cloud.

Requirements:

  • Logging the data to the cloud over WiFI network
  • Firmware upgrade via BLE interface
  • Sub GHz mesh network

Major components:

  • STM32L552
  • ATWINC3400
  • SPSGRF-915
  • SST26VF032

Number of PCB layers: 4

BOM price: 58 USD

Realization time: 8 weeks

Inspection device

Live image streaming via wireless link at rates up to 35 FPS is main feature of the dental device. Two variants of the board where built in order to explore the image size vs required throughput performance on the FPS rate.

Requirements:

  • Steel image capture up to resolution of 640×480
  • JPEG image streaming up to 35FPS@320×240 via WIFI network
  • device network configuration via BLE interface
  • device configuration storage in non-volatile memory
  • battery charging and monitoring capabilities

Major components:

  • STM32H750
  • ATWINC3400
  • OV7690
  • 24CW1280
  • BQ24074

Number of PCB layers : 4

Realization time: 10 weeks

BOM price: 63 USD

Second device utilized the BGA camera cube and 0201 components.

Milking controller

CAN controlled and configurable milking controller for cattle milk dispensing. By employing complex actuator sequence realized through the two PWM channels and three ADC channels on pressure sensors, a smart milking system is realized. Status messages are shown on a small 320×240 TFT display.

Requirements:

  • CAN network over opto-islated controller
  • TFT LCD display for system status
  • Firmware upgrade via CAN interface
  • Differential pressure monitoring
  • System parameter storage on non-volatile memory

Major components:

  • STM32F103
  • ADM3053
  • ZXMS6005DG
  • W25Q32
  • MPX5500 & MPXV5100

Number of PCB layers: 2

BOM price: 99 USD

Realization time: 8 weeks

BLE Fishing Bobber

A multi-board system designed for purpose of improving fishing experience. System includes remote controller with BLE and sub-GHz communication interface, keypad and OLED display. On the remote side a board that allows RGB light control for purpose of bait simulation, sonar, motor controller and IMU. System allows up to 4 fishing bobbers to be added into subGHz start network.

Requirements:

  • BLE and subGHz communication interface for device control,
  • OLED display and keyboard for device configuration and control,
  • RGB LED lights for fish attraction,
  • Sonar and motor control for bait simulation and detection,
  • Low power profile,

Major components:

  • STM32L476 & nRF52832
  • SPSGFR-915
  • LIS2DE12, PGA460
  • BQ24074, DRV8837
  • LMR62421, TPS62740
  • OLED 96×96

Number of PCB layers: 4

BOM price: 117 USD

Realization time: 12 weeks

Spray Head

NFC reader and two stepper motor drivers are integrated into this small board. The board allows identification of the spray head through small 25 mm NFC Type 2 tag and serves as mechanism for master device to distribute spray content per predefined algorithm.

Requirements:

  • NFC Type 2 Tag reader
  • Stepper motor controller
  • UART communication,

Major components:

  • STM32F401
  • DRV8821
  • CR95HF
  • AZ1117

Number of PCB layers: 4

BOM price: 32 USD

Realization time: 6 weeks